IONIA. Uncertain. Circa 600-550 BC. Stater (Electrum, 20 mm, 16.56 g), Phokaic standard. Chimaera, with a lion's body, open jaws and a heavy mane, a goats head and neck, and a serpent tail, standing left. Rev. Two irregular incuse squares of unequal size. BMC Ionia 41 and pl. II, 2 = PCG I A, 18. Extremely rare and of great interest. Minor die rust and edge splits, otherwise, good very fine.

From a European collection and that of J. P. Rosen, ex Roma XV, 5 April 2018, 140.
